Company Overview
Ukpea?vik Iupiat Corporation (UIC) is the village corporation of Barrow, Alaska and is recognized as one of Alaska’s top 10 companies with approximately 4,000 employees nationwide and revenues above $700M annually. UIC is projected to grow substantially in the coming years to become a top 3 company in Alaska by 2030.

Job Summary

Human Resources Coordinator SUMMARY:
The HR Coordinator is responsible for all new hire orientation and regular maintenance of the company personnel files and records, with emphasis on HRIS / HCM database. This incumbent will also participate in the new hire onboarding with other department such as Safety, HSET to ensure new hires are thoroughly on boarded before arriving to the job-site or work place.

Will provide intermediate HR services in areas of employee or supervisory inquiries in new hire process, recruitment, performance management, policy, benefits, compensation, HR compliance, where necessary. Must be knowledgeable in the company policy and procedure while informing employees on proper protocol and processes.
